The painting The American Ship Independence Off Liverpool by Samuel Walters (1811–1882) is a captivating maritime masterpiece that transports viewers to the bustling docks of 19th-century Liverpool. Walters, a renowned British marine painter, meticulously captures the grandeur of the American vessel Independence as it dominates the composition, its towering masts and billowing sails exuding power and grace. The choppy waters shimmer with reflections of the overcast sky, while smaller boats and distant port buildings add depth and context. Painted with precise realism and dramatic lighting, the work embodies the ship portrait genre popular during the Age of Sail, reflecting both Liverpool’s significance as a global trade hub and the transatlantic maritime rivalry of the era. Historically, Walters' paintings are celebrated for their technical accuracy and atmospheric storytelling, making this piece a valuable record of nautical heritage and a testament to the artist’s skill in balancing documentary detail with artistic beauty.
